Basement Stairs Repair in Alpharetta, GA
Basement stairs repair services address issues related to the safety, stability, and appearance of staircases leading to basement areas. These projects often involve fixing loose or broken treads, handrails, and banisters, as well as repairing or replacing damaged stringers and supports. Homeowners may seek these services to prevent accidents, improve accessibility, or restore the overall look of their basement entryway, especially if the stairs show signs of wear, sagging, or structural damage.

Common Basement Stairs Repair Jobs
Basement stairs repair involves fixing loose or broken steps to ensure safe access.
Structural reinforcement includes stabilizing or replacing damaged stringers and supports.
Riser and tread replacement restores worn or damaged stair components for safety and appearance.
Handrail and balustrade repair ensures proper support and compliance with safety standards.
Water damage restoration addresses issues caused by leaks or flooding that weaken stair structures.
Custom stair modifications adapt existing stairs to better fit space or aesthetic preferences.
Basement Stairs Repair Questions
What types of basement stair repairs are common? Repairs often include fixing loose or broken treads, replacing damaged handrails, and addressing structural issues like sagging or wobbling stairs.
How can I tell if my basement stairs need repair? Signs include creaking sounds, wobbly steps, visible cracks, or uneven surfaces that affect safety and stability.
Are there options to improve the safety of basement stairs? Yes, installing sturdy handrails, non-slip treads, and proper lighting can enhance safety and reduce the risk of accidents.
What materials are typically used for basement stair repairs? Common materials include wood for treads and risers, metal for handrails, and concrete or steel for structural reinforcement.
